• 专利标题:   Preparing uniformly heated ceramic crucible involves adding aluminum, feldspar, steatite, graphene oxide powder and raw material to remove impurity, taking talcum and feldspar in kiln furnace for calcining, grinding and adding water.

▎ 摘  要

NOVELTY - Preparing uniformly heated ceramic crucible involves adding 16.11% aluminum, 20.19% feldspar, 38.21% steatite, 25.49% graphene oxide powder and raw material to remove impurity, taking talcum and feldspar in kiln furnace for calcining and grinding. The water is added to dilute and mixed uniformly. The mixture is placed into kiln and clinker, calcined for 5 hours and cooling. The prepared aluminum powder is placed in aluminum powder ball mill. The proper amount of graphene oxide powder is taken and put into suitable container. The water is added to stir uniformly, and ultrasonic oscillation is performed for 5 hours to improve dispersibility. The prepared mixed material, aluminum powder and oxide graphene suspension are mixed. The mixed solution is stirred and irradiated for 24 hours. The far infrared ray is used. The oxidized graphene is converted into graphene, and attached on surface of aluminum powder to combine with aluminum powder. The clinker is used for grinding. USE - Method for preparing uniformly heated ceramic crucible. ADVANTAGE - The method enables to prepare uniformly heated ceramic crucible that improves food cooking quality, saves energy, and in eco-friendly manner. DETAILED DESCRIPTION - The frit powder is added and stirred. The mixed material is mixed in suspension to adjust water content to prepare slurry. The slurry is used into proper shape of ceramic cooker blank, mol, dried and placed in shady place. The 3.31% pyrophyllite, 2.17% borocalcite, 10.8% ascharite, 33.2% limestone, 8.1% quartz sand, 15.04% dolomite and 27.38% asbestos and raw material are added to remove impurity. The proper amount of pyrophyllite, colemanite, ascharite, quartz sand, limestone and dolomite is taken into kiln to calcine after grinding. The water is added to dilute and mixed. The block is placed into kiln and calcined for 4 hours, cooled naturally and grinded. The frit powder and asbestos powder is palced into proper container, mixed and proper amount of water is added to prepare glazewater. The green ceramic pot is used to glaze enameling water. The obtained product is molded and fired in kiln.
